I am developing a blockchain based food supply chain project in which I have to create raw products as well as a finished product (nugget in my case). I have created an ERC 721 contract for tracking the process but now I have to add that one nugget token contains several raw material tokens. Is it possible? Like a token consisting of an array of other tokens?
